I'm excited to be here. HOST: Great! Let's dive right in. Can you share your personal experience with drone technology in agriculture? GUEST: Absolutely! I've seen firsthand how drones can increase efficiency in crop monitoring and livestock management. The data they collect helps farmers make informed decisions, leading to higher yields and profitability. HOST: That's impressive. Now, shifting gears a bit, what current trends are you seeing in the industry when it comes to drone technology? GUEST: Well, there's growing interest in using drones for precision agriculture, which involves using data to apply fertilizers and pesticides only where needed. This not only saves costs but also reduces environmental impact. HOST: I can imagine that being a game-changer. Now, every field has its challenges. What would you say are some obstacles faced in implementing drone technology in smart farm management? GUEST: Regulatory compliance is a major challenge. Farmers need to understand and follow rules around drone flights, data privacy, and safety. Additionally, there's a learning curve in operating drones and interpreting the data they collect. HOST: Those are important considerations. Looking toward the future, where do you see this area heading in the next 5-10 years? GUEST: I believe drone technology will become even more integrated into daily farm operations. We'll see advancements in AI and machine learning that enable drones to make real-time decisions, further increasing efficiency and sustainability. HOST: That sounds fascinating!
